Live events, meetings, and broadcasts do not wait for post-processing — participants need information as it happens. Real-time transcription bridges the gap between spoken and written communication, providing instant text that helps hearing-impaired participants follow along, enables real-time note-taking, and creates a written record simultaneously with the conversation. Blazescribe's real-time engine delivers sub-3-second latency with speaker identification, meaning participants see who is saying what almost as quickly as they hear it. After the live session ends, the transcript undergoes full processing for maximum accuracy, and all of Blazescribe's AI features — summarization, content generation, and search — become available. Organizations use real-time transcription for accessibility compliance, live event captioning, and meetings where immediate written records are essential.

Real-Time Transcription FAQ
Common questions about Real-Time Transcription in Blazescribe.
Most words appear within 2-3 seconds of being spoken. This near-instant latency makes the live transcript useful for following along during meetings, presentations, and events.
Real-time transcription prioritizes speed and achieves approximately 95% accuracy live. After the session ends, the transcript is refined using our full processing pipeline, bringing accuracy up to 98%+.
Yes. Run a real-time transcription session in your browser while on a Zoom or Teams call. The system captures audio from your selected source and transcribes live.
No. Real-time sessions can run for any duration — from a quick 10-minute standup to a multi-hour conference. The system maintains performance throughout.
